Conditions

Health Condition 1: G819- Hemiplegia, unspecified

Interventions

Intervention1: PARANGI KASAYAM (ORAL ADMINISTRATION): Should be administrated orally twice a day after food for 48 days. Dosage : 2-4 years : 10 ml 4-7 years : 15 ml 7-12 years :

Eligibility

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: Stiffness and weekness in muscles on one side of the body Pain Muscle spasm Delayed milestones Difficulty with walking and balance

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: Children below 2 years Children above 12 years Congenoital cardiac failure Infantile hemiplegia with associated congenital abnormalities Infantile hemiplegia with co-morbidities like mental retardation and muscular dystrophy

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
To access the effectiveness of PARANGI KASAYAM AND VARMAM THERAPHY in the management of BALAR PAKKA VATHAM in children by using GMFCS, MACS, EDACS rating scale to improve their mobility and regain their functional independenceTimepoint: 48 DAYS
